Regular maintenance National Churches Trust

WebThe four main reasons for maintaining your church building are: preserving heritage: regular, minimal and small-scale work helps maintains original features and fabric; ... We encourage churches to follow a maintenance checklist (or plan) in order to keep track of what needs doing and when, and we require applicants to our Grant Programmes to ... WebFeb 1, 2013 · Row lengths and seating: Average minimum space per person, 20 inches width; more realistic, 24 inches; 13 or 14 persons maximum on each row.
